Abstract
A composition for supporting endogenous systems related to life span, inhibiting mTOR, and reducing damage associated with oxidative phosphorylation. The composition comprises an upregulating compound mixture configured to upregulate an endogenous antioxidant system, an exogenous antioxidant mixture configured to inhibit oxidation of biomolecules by reactive oxygen species, and a mineral mixture configured to provide one or more cofactors to a endogenous antioxidant enzyme. The endogenous antioxidant system includes regulation of mitophagy through mTOR mediated regulation, and a Nrf2 transcription factors that promotes transcription of antioxidant genes.
